Is the invoice it produces legally compliant?

It follows standard conventions — itemised services, dates, totals, payment terms — and leaves placeholders for the details only you can supply: your business number, tax registration, and the tax treatment that applies to you. Requirements differ by country and business type, so check what your tax office expects (in Australia, whether it must be a tax invoice showing GST) before it goes out.

Does it calculate the totals for me?

It will add lines and apply the percentages you specify, but arithmetic is a known weak spot for AI, so run every figure past a calculator before sending. The sensible split: let the tool handle layout, item descriptions and wording, and treat the numbers as yours to confirm. A wrong total costs more credibility with a client than a plain-looking invoice ever will.

Can it match the invoice numbering I already use?

Tell it your format and the next number in your sequence — INV-2026-041, say — and it slots it in. What it cannot do is track the sequence for you, because nothing carries over between sessions. Keep your own register of issued numbers, even a simple spreadsheet, so you never send two clients the same invoice number.

How should I word the payment terms so I actually get paid on time?

Name a specific due date rather than vague phrases like 'payment on receipt', state the accepted payment methods, and if you charge late fees, say so plainly on the invoice itself. Ask the tool for firm-but-polite terms and it will draft wording that sets expectations without souring the relationship — clear terms up front beat awkward chasing later.
